A servo drive motor is a type of motor that is paired with a servo drive to control the position, velocity, and acceleration of the motor. The servo drive acts as the brain of the system, receiving commands and feedback signals to regulate the motor’s performance. This closed-loop system ensures precise control over the motor’s movement, making it ideal for applications that require accuracy and repeatability.

One of the key advantages of servo drive motors is their ability to provide high torque at low speeds. This torque capability allows for quick acceleration and deceleration, making them well-suited for applications that require fast and precise movements. Whether it’s a robotic arm performing delicate assembly tasks or a CNC machine cutting intricate designs, servo drive motors can deliver the performance needed to meet the demands of modern industrial processes.

Another major benefit of servo drive motors is their ability to operate in a wide range of speeds. Unlike traditional motors that operate at a fixed speed, servo drive motors can be easily programmed to run at variable speeds, making them adaptable to different operating conditions. This flexibility allows for greater control over the motor’s performance, ensuring optimal efficiency and productivity in industrial applications.

Furthermore, servo drive motors offer superior accuracy and positioning capabilities. With the help of encoders and feedback devices, servo drive motors can precisely control the motor’s position and velocity, ensuring that it reaches its target positions with high precision. This level of accuracy is crucial in applications where quality and consistency are paramount, such as in the manufacturing of electronic components or medical devices.
